Introduction to Green Ammonia Production
In a groundbreaking development, Australian researchers have unveiled a revolutionary method to produce green ammonia using plasma technology. This innovative approach allows for the extraction of ammonia gas directly from the air, presenting a cleaner alternative to the conventional fossil fuel-reliant Haber-Bosch process.
The new plasma-based method is not only cost-effective but also scalable, making it a promising solution for sustainable ammonia production. This advancement could significantly reduce the environmental impact of ammonia manufacturing, which is essential for various applications including fertilizers and energy storage.
